The guest room that the grand-kids usually stay in was our focus.
The bed spread was our starting point. Once we found the quilted floral design with the colors we liked best everything else fell into place quite quickly. The bedding is a mix of two sets. The floral from Marshall's and the solid coral orange colored quilted set from Ross. *Both were purchased for less than half the price of the original design we wanted from a catalog. Score! And didn't have to wait for or pay for shipping either.
The green pillow is from Pier One and it is very soft and plush.
Blue pillow was one she already had stored in a closet and it perfectly coordinated. Love when that happens.
Lamp is from Lowe's filled with delicate coral orange floral stem from Pier One.

This is the dresser that I sanded down and painted a gorgeous shade of blue.

Also replaced the wooden knobs with mercury glass knobs from Hobby Lobby...on sale 1/2 price.

Some of our accessories: metal tray 60% off at Michaels. Mercury glass timer Hobby Lobby. Greenery and vase from Marshall's along with the blue candle. Ceramic bird...already had. Coral flowers added to the arrangement are from the same bunch as in the lamp.
